WebJun 30, 2006 · The old way: optical anisotropy factor (OAF) The simplest measurement of the Optical Anisotropy Factor (OAF) consists of two measurements with a microscope: one with the input beam polarized along the radius of the particle, the other with the input beam polarized perpendicular to this radius.
